Why the Safety Index is a Red Flag
A Safety Index of 0.9 out of 10 is not just low. It’s a warning flare. We tested their Terms and Conditions and found clauses that are less about protecting the player and more about giving the casino an out when it comes time to pay. Combine that with a high number of denied payout complaints relative to the casino’s size, and you have a pattern that’s hard to ignore. The casino is licensed in Curaçao and Mexico, but a license is only as good as the enforcement behind it.
The Complaints and the Fine Print
We currently have 33 complaints about this casino in our database, tallying up to 10,000 black points. That’s a lot of heat for a casino of its estimated size. The T&Cs are the main culprit. Unfair rules are the easiest way for a casino to legally dodge paying out. If you value your winnings, you need to understand what you’re signing up for.

- Ambiguous language around bonus wagering that can reset your progress.
- Unreasonable withdrawal limits buried in the fine print.
- Clauses that allow for account closure or confiscation of funds without a clear, justified reason.
A Look at the Game Library and Support
To be fair, the game selection isn’t the problem. They offer slots, roulette, blackjack, baccarat, live dealer games, and even crash games from 33 different providers, including NetEnt, Playtech, and Nolimit City. The variety is there. The problem is what happens when something goes wrong. Our team contacted customer support and found it to be slow and unhelpful. A good game library means nothing if you can’t get your money out or get a straight answer.

The Bonuses: Shiny Hooks, Sharp Barbs
They offer a 400% match up to €2,000, plus 100 extra spins. That’s a massive bonus. And massive bonuses usually come with massive strings attached. The wagering requirements, game restrictions, and max bet limits are where things get sticky. The 100% match up to €1,000 is more standard, but still tied to the same unfair T&Cs. Don’t let the headline number fool you.
- Read the bonus T&Cs word for word. Look for the wagering contribution percentages.
- Test support with a specific withdrawal question. See how long they take to respond.
- Start with the minimum deposit. Never assume a big bonus is safe until you’ve verified the terms.
